I'm going to be blunt with you here:

Never. Ever. Include sped up gameplay. You are here to showcase the good parts, or to share your commentary on your choices and gameplay. So if you end up grinding, you'd be wise to cut those parts out, and instead show how your team has improved afterwards. As I skimmed through this video, nearly all of it is fast-forwarded gameplay. No one wants to see that. Even the capture of Shinx was made without comments, and just achieved in a hurry with no sense of importance.
